PTFE extruded rods have become a critical component in various industrial applications due to their exceptional properties. Among their standout features are excellent dielectric properties, which make them ideal for high-speed signal transmission. With a low dielectric constant of approximately 2.1 and an extremely low dissipation factor around 0.0002, PTFE rods facilitate minimal signal loss, particularly in radio frequency (RF) and microwave applications. According to industry reports, these properties allow PTFE to maintain signal integrity even at high frequencies, highlighting its irreplaceability in advanced electronic applications.
The thermal stability of PTFE extruded rods further enhances their utility across diverse environments. These rods can withstand an impressive temperature range from -190°C to +260°C for prolonged use, withstanding short stints at temperatures exceeding 300°C without deformation. This exceptional resistance to both low and high temperatures ensures their reliability in demanding applications without compromising structural integrity. Reports from thermal property studies underscore PTFE's ability to resist decomposition at elevated temperatures, meeting stringent flame-retardant standards, which is critical in safety-sensitive environments.
Additionally, PTFE rods exhibit remarkable surface characteristics, including a very low coefficient of friction, around 0.05 to 0.10, making them ideally suited for applications requiring self-lubrication and non-stick properties. This low surface energy contributes to outstanding hydrophobic and oleophobic capabilities, preventing liquids from wetting the surface. Such chemical inertness makes PTFE a preferred choice in aggressive chemical environments, where it remains stable against strong acids and alkalis, solidifying its reputation as the "King of Plastics." These features combined make PTFE extruded rods indispensable in industries ranging from electronics to advanced manufacturing.
